Lectures on the principles of programming TEACHING THE STUDY SKILLS. lowaU 1962 28min sd color $210. rent $8.25 c-ad Demonstrates optimum procedure for teaching the work-study skills. Carries the viewer through each of the steps involved in proper teaching of the study skills through an illustrative sequence of lessons on the teaching of one aspect of index usage TEACHING TIME RELATIONSHIPS IN ELEMENTARY SCHOOLS. Bailey 1962 12min sd color $130. rent $7.50 c-ad Guide Produced by Ruth O. Bradley Shows how a variety of activities can help children to relate experiences in the past. g resent, and future. Demonstrates methods for elping elementary children learn concepts of time, emphasizing the need for an on-going growth process in understanding time relationships. Shows that the development of mural, calendar, and photographic time line charts by children of different age levels offers a readiness program for understanding and interpreting history EFLA evaluation card No. 4735 TEAMWORK IN TURKEY. Family 1961 30min sd (Teenage ser) b&w rent $15. color rent $22.50 Jh-sh Guide Shows a group of teenagers busy at the church putting together a large outdoor nativity scene. Some of them are doing it almost grudgingly, however, as they reveal how they are caught up in the mad rush of pressures and the commercialization of the Christmas season. Two young people come around asking a lot of questions while they are building the nativity scene and are rather brusquely put off. Later the children completely wreck it with snowballs and take one of the costumes. The teenagers learn a big lesson themselves about the true meaning of Christmas as they tell the story of the coming of Christ to the children TEENAGE ROMANCE.
